这里是文章模块栏目内容页
mysql显示代码区(mysql源代码)

导读:MySQL是一种开源的关系型数据库管理系统,广泛应用于Web应用程序的后台数据存储。在MySQL中,显示代码区是一个非常重要的功能,可以帮助开发人员更好地理解和调试SQL语句。本文将介绍如何在MySQL中使用显示代码区功能,并提供一些实用技巧。

一、什么是MySQL的显示代码区?

显示代码区是MySQL命令行客户端中的一个功能,可以用来显示SQL语句执行的详细信息。通过启用该功能,可以查看SQL语句的执行计划、查询优化器的决策、索引使用情况等信息,从而帮助开发人员更好地优化SQL语句。

二、如何启用MySQL的显示代码区?

要启用MySQL的显示代码区,只需要在执行SQL语句前加上“EXPLAIN”关键字即可。例如,要显示“SELECT * FROM users WHERE age > 18”这条SQL语句的执行计划,可以输入以下命令:

EXPLAIN SELECT * FROM users WHERE age > 18;

三、如何解读MySQL的显示代码区输出?

MySQL的显示代码区输出包含很多信息,其中比较重要的几个指标包括:

1. id:每个查询子句都会被赋予一个唯一的id,表示该子句在查询中的位置。

2. select_type:表示查询类型,有SIMPLE、PRIMARY、SUBQUERY、DERIVED、UNION等几种类型。

3. table:表示该查询子句涉及的表名。

4. type:表示访问表的方式,有ALL、index、range、ref、eq_ref和const等几种方式。

5. rows:表示访问表时扫描的行数。

通过这些指标,可以帮助开发人员更好地理解SQL语句的执行过程,并进行优化。

总结:MySQL的显示代码区是一个非常实用的功能,可以帮助开发人员更好地理解和优化SQL语句。本文介绍了如何启用MySQL的显示代码区,并提供了一些实用技巧。希望本文能够对大家在使用MySQL时有所帮助。